New Delhi, April 15 -- The Jawaharlal Nehru University Students' Union (JNUSU) elections are set for a charged contest, with 165 nominations filed for the four central panel posts.

According to the election committee, the post of President attracted the highest number of candidates, 48, followed by 42 for General Secretary, 41 for Vice President, and 34 for Joint Secretary.

For the 16 school counsellor positions, 250 students have submitted their nominations.

The election process formally began on April 14 with the release of the provisional voter list. The Election Committee has confirmed that 7,906 students are eligible to vote this year, with women comprising 43% of the electorate.
